What this means for your family

While some staff members are noted for their hard work and dedication to resident safety, there are alarming reports regarding a lack of communication with families during critical moments. If you choose this facility, you must establish a rigorous, documented communication plan with the administration to ensure you are notified of all significant resident changes.

State Inspection History

State Inspections

Source: NC Division of Health Service Regulation

2total
3deficiencies
Aug 17, 2017Other
Physical EnvironmentD 072

The facility failed to maintain the outside grounds in a clean and safe condition. Specifically, nine chairs on the front porch were in poor condition, featuring rusted metal, ripped cushions, exposed padding, and cigarette ash. Residents and staff confirmed that the furniture had remained in this dilapidated state for months or even over a year without cleaning.

Aug 17, 2017Other
Physical EnvironmentC-tag not explicitly provided

The facility failed to maintain the outside grounds in a clean and safe condition. Specifically, several chairs on the front porch were in disrepair, including rusted metal, torn cushions, and accumulated cigarette ash.

Housekeeping And FurnishingsC-tag not explicitly provided

The facility failed to ensure that walls, ceilings, and floors were kept clean and in good repair. Deficiencies were noted in multiple bathrooms and bedrooms, including rusty vents, chipped paint, broken floor tiles, and damaged wall surfaces.
